The Importance of Communication

Communication is a cornerstone of any healthy relationship. When it comes to sex, open dialogue about preferences, desires, and boundaries can greatly enhance intimacy.

  • Express Your Desires: Share what you enjoy and what you’re curious about with your partner. This could involve discussing specific sexual fantasies or techniques you wish to explore.
  • Talk About Intimacy: Discuss the broader concepts of intimacy beyond sex, including affection, trust, and vulnerability. Building a strong emotional connection can significantly enrich your sexual experiences.
  • Feedback is Key: After intimate moments, engage in a discussion about what worked and what can be improved. This practice fosters trust and understanding.

Importance of Consent and Boundaries

A fulfilling intimate life is built on trust, respect, and mutual consent. Understanding boundaries is essential for a healthy sexual relationship.

Navigate Consent

Always prioritize clear and enthusiastic consent. Consent should never be assumed; instead, it should be openly discussed and negotiated.

  • Continuous Consent: Understand that consent can evolve over time and may change during intimate experiences. Always check in with your partner.

Respect Boundaries

Boundaries protect the emotional and physical safety of both partners.

  • Discuss Limits: Before engaging in sexual activities, discuss what each partner is comfortable with. This fosters a sense of safety and trust.

Addressing Sexual Concerns

Many couples face challenges in their sexual relationships. It’s essential to address any issues instead of leaving them unresolved.

Open Discussions

If sexual dissatisfaction occurs, address it without blame or shame. Honest discussions help navigate these challenges.

  • Seek Solutions Together: Focus on what you can do as a team to improve your intimate life.

Professional Help

If concerns persist, consider seeking professional advice from a licensed therapist or sexologist. Therapy can provide tools to navigate relationship issues and enhance intimacy.
